Responsibilities
- Manage complex calendars, schedule meetings, and coordinate domestic and international travel arrangements for executive leadership.
- Prepare and edit correspondence, presentations, and reports with a high degree of accuracy and professionalism.
- Screen incoming communications, including phone calls and emails, routing inquiries to the appropriate personnel while maintaining confidentiality.
- Organize and maintain physical and digital filing systems to ensure easy access to critical business information.
- Assist with event planning, including office parties, client meetings, and corporate retreats, ensuring all logistics are executed flawlessly.
- Act as the primary point of contact for internal and external stakeholders, representing the company with a positive image.
Qualifications
-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in an administrative or executive support role.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and CRM software.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to draft professional correspondence.
- Strong organizational and time management abilities with a keen eye for detail and accuracy.
- Ability to prioritize tasks and work independently in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
- High school diploma required; Associate’s degree or equivalent experience preferred.
